Information Collection and Use
We collect the following information for the purposes of improving the stability of the application and managing purchases. Also, the App uses third-party services that may collect information used to identify the user.
Link to the privacy policy of third-party service providers used by the App:
We do not collect any information that reveals the content the user handles (such as filenames, bibliographic information, or image data). Therefore, we have no way of knowing the content the user processes.
Sentry
To identify app defects and improve stability, we primarily collect the following information:
- Error and Crash Information
- The section of code that caused the error (stack trace).
- Information about the state of the App at the time the error occurred.
- Device Information
- OS version and device model.
- App version.
- Device language settings and country.
RevenueCat
For the purpose of managing purchases, we primarily collect the following information:
- Purchase-related Information
- The user’s purchase history (such as purchased items, date and time of purchase, expiration date, etc.)
- Anonymous ID
- A random, non-personally identifiable identifier automatically generated by RevenueCat.

Your Privacy Rights Under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A/CPRA)
This section applies to users who are residents of California, based on the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) and the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A).
Users who are residents of California are granted the following rights regarding their personal information.
- Right to Know: The right to request disclosure of the categories of personal information we have collected about you, the sources from which the personal information is collected, the purpose for collecting, selling, or sharing personal information, and the categories of third parties to whom we disclose, sell, or share personal information.
- Right to Delete: The right to request the deletion of your personal information that we have collected, subject to certain exceptions.
- Right to Correct: The right to request the correction of inaccurate personal information that we maintain about you.
- Right to Opt-Out of Sale or Sharing: We do not sell your personal information for monetary consideration, nor do we share personal information for cross-context behavioral advertising.
- Right to Limit Use and Disclosure of Sensitive Personal Information: We do not intentionally collect or use sensitive personal information as defined by the CPRA (such as precise geolocation, race, religion, genetic data, etc.).
- Right to Non-Discrimination: The right not to receive discriminatory treatment for exercising your rights under the CPRA.
